Output 74bf6d5766e4243b4d54ba2496231d39621365d24ffcaaf6dc058b44a9664788:0

value
655174482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 234ae49765cc4db9ca6bc9e4ba12bdb4c2021c81 OP_EQUAL
address
34udHuk6QZgKLJsW5GNmT1zrmZLhs2G9kE
transaction
74bf6d5766e4243b4d54ba2496231d39621365d24ffcaaf6dc058b44a9664788
spent
true